Police in Pennsylvania said six high school students are facing pornography charges after three girls sent photos of themselves via cell phones.
Greensburg police said the three female Greensburg-Salem High School students, ages 14 and 15, have been charged in Westmoreland County with manufacturing, disseminating or possessing child pornography after they allegedly took pictures of themselves -- two of the girls nude, the other semi-nude -- with their cell phones and sent them to other students, the Pittsburgh Tribune-Review reported Tuesday.

This actually is a neighboring school district...so I have been following it in our local media. According to the last report locally, PA law would regard the possession of the pix by the receiver as possession of kiddie porn; if they forwarded the pictures to anybody (any age) that would be distributing kiddie porn. The girls (in the photos) would also be guilty of possession and distribution. BUT...in PA the local District Attorney (for Westmoreland County) has some wiggle room...not a lot BUT this may not be life ruining (just financially ruining for the parents involved as they all lawyer up).
